At 4.5" of lift with the new curved LCAs I dont really have enough lift to need them, I thought I did but I dont. I could order straight arms and use the drop brackets but that seems unnecessary. I was hoping to get a little more flex with the drop brackets and the new LCAs but the new LCAs (XD version looks like the pic but 1.5" solid) give me room for 1-2" more axle droop on there own and are too curved to work with the drop brackets because the eyes end up level (with the curve facing down).

I might hang onto them until I find some 6" coils and leaf packs or add spacers and do a rear shackle relocation which will give me a steep enough angle to need the drop brackets but I rather sell them...
